.NET Technical Lead (Remote)

Remote • Posted 3 hours ago • Updated 3 hours ago
Contract W2
Contract Independent
Remote
$68 - $72/hr
Company Branding Image
Fitment

Dice Job Match Score™

👾 Reticulating splines...

Job Details

Skills

  • PROGRAMMER IV
  • SENIOR PROGRAMMER
  • NET
  • NET CORE
  • NET 6
  • C#
  • C#.NET
  • ASP.NET
  • MICROSOFT MVC
  • WEB FORMS
  • SQL
  • MICROSOFT SQL SERVER
  • SQL SERVER 2019
  • VISUAL STUDIO
  • MICROSOFT STUDIO
  • AGILE
  • SCRUM MASTER
  • CI/CD
  • CONTINUOUS INTEGRATION
  • CONTINUOUS DELIVERY

Summary

The .NET Technical Lead serves as a senior technical leader, delivering guidance and training, mentoring the development team, providing technical oversight, and spearheading complex system design and software application development projects. This role entails managing a development team while also contributing locally to crucial design, documentation, deployment, and process improvement tasks in collaboration with business management and enterprise architects. The .NET Technical Lead plays a pivotal role in supporting organizational goals and initiatives through technical discussions or analytics, system process design, code development, testing, and application support, working either independently or as a team lead. In addition, the .NET Technical Lead provides team leadership, establishes technical standards for the development team, and works closely with the management team to continuously refine project management and agile development methodology, procedures, and policies in order to promote efficiency and productivity. The position will be required to lead, work with, and mentor people of various professional, vocational, and educational backgrounds.

Essential Duties and Responsibilities:

<>Leadership
  • Provide strong technical direction and guidance, project management skills using the Project Management Institute (PMI) methodology, and related abilities to facilitate, execute, and accomplish corporate and maintenance project deliverables.
  • Provide technical leadership for all aspects of Application development, lead technical teams using the Agile methodology for incremental product delivery, independently perform Scrum Master duties, and promote Agile best practices for continuous improvement.
  • Facilitate and lead collaborative cross-functional workgroups to resolve complex problems in real-time to reduce or mitigate operational interruptions.
  • Mentor junior team members in the following areas: ORM technologies such as Entity Framework or NHibernate, ASP.NET websites using Microsoft MVC and Web Forms and utilizing AJAX methodologies, Microsoft WCF services, Windows services, and Web API using SOAP/XML or JSON, front-end web development languages such as HTML 5, CSS 3, and JavaScript and frameworks such as jQuery, Kendo UI, Knockout.js, Angular.js, or jQuery UI, and enterprise-grade source control repositories such as Microsoft Team Foundation Server.
<>Technical
  • Create application programs from specifications designed and provide development of logical software programs using modern technologies such as .NET Core or .NET 6 or above.
  • Expertise with multiple object-oriented programming languages implementing design patterns, test-driven development (TDD) methods, and multi-tiered applications.
  • Expertise in development and implementation of applications or solutions using Visual Studio and C#.NET.
  • Expertise in creating complex structured query language (SQL) statements for analytical data mining, software development, or business reporting.
  • Expertise in designing relational databases using Microsoft SQL server 2019 and above.
  • Experience in implementing EDI solutions using enterprise-grade tools such as Microsoft BizTalk Server or SQL Server Integration Services (SSIS).
  • Develop and maintain domain architectures for complex problems ensuring alignment with organizational strategies and business objectives.
  • Implement and support CI/CD (continuous integration/continuous delivery) practices to streamline the software development lifecycle.
  • Utilize experience with AI tools, including ChatGPT and other AI solutions to enhance and optimize processes where applicable.
<>Administrative
  • Independently evaluate, select, and integrate third-party tools within a Visual Studio Environment to assist in the development of internal applications and engage third-party vendors in problem resolution and enhancements.
  • Proactively interact with management, business, and technical analysts in review and design of new concepts and ideas, project implementation, and problem resolution.
  • Provide technical feasibility studies in support of projects and ensure system documentation is accurate and current.
  • Provide user application education and act as liaison in application support for various business functions that will include multiple departments.
  • Supervise and coordinate deployment of application code and related change management process, including collaboration with technical resources such as systems engineers and database administrators.
  • Work in coordination with system engineers on all major infrastructure changes to assess business impact and communication methods.
  • Analyze and monitor system and database impact metrics prior to deploying code to production.
  • Supervise and coordinate application demonstrations, user acceptance testing, new implementations, and upgrades.
  • Proactively assume ownership of initial or escalated help desk incidents, change management requests, problem tickets, and other work as assigned that cannot be resolved at a lower level.
  • Actively attend webinars and conferences as they pertain to application development and maintenance, direction, and industry standardization.
  • Determine industry changes and make appropriate recommendations to management for future technical direction.

Education and Experience:

Bachelor''s degree from an accredited school or equivalent in Computer Science, Mathematics, or related field and eight (8) years of progressive programming or application development experience in a medium to large organization with a structured IT department preferably in healthcare using Microsoft Studio, C#, ASP.NET, MSSQL, and relevant tools. Education can be substituted with Programming work experience on a year-for-year basis.

OR

Twelve (12) years of progressive programming or application development experience in a medium to large organization with a structured IT department preferably in healthcare using Microsoft Studio, C#, ASP.NET, MSSQL, and relevant tools.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
  • Dice Id: 91138017
  • Position Id: 26-00430
  • Posted 3 hours ago

Company Info

About OP Consulting Group LLC

OP Consulting Group was formed by an IT Consultant who was frustrated with the current practices in the staffing industry. With a determination to bring change in the staffing practices, we came up with some bold business practices. We also offer complimenting services of Training and Consulting.

We are not just a middleman but are your partner to help turn your goals into reality. We do not see a job opportunity as a single transaction but the beginning of a long-term relationship.

OP Consulting Group’s promises to you are:
• Upfront and transparent pay rate
• We keep low margins
• Frequent and proactive communication of submission status
• We only work with direct clients or prime vendors
• On-time payment

About_Company_OneAbout_Company_Two
Create job alert
Set job alertNever miss an opportunity! Create an alert based on the job you applied for.

Similar Jobs

It looks like there aren't any Similar Jobs for this job yet.

Search all similar jobs